#3bbccb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3bbccb is composed of 23.1% red, 73.7%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.9% cyan, 7.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 186.3 degrees, a saturation of 58.1% and a lightness of 51.4%. #3bbccb color hex could be obtained by blending #76ffff with #007997.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#3bbccb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010506 is the darkest color, while #f5fcfc is the lightest one.
